Understanding the Problem: Why Is the Apple Weather App Not Working?

Before diving into the solutions, it is essential to understand the potential causes behind the Weather app’s malfunction on your iPhone. Identifying the root cause will help you choose the most effective solution and prevent similar issues from occurring in the future. Here are some of the most common reasons why the Weather app may not be working properly:

  • Location services are deactivated or insufficient permissions: The Weather app relies on your iPhone’s location services to provide precise and relevant weather data for your region. If location services are turned off or if you have not granted the necessary permissions to the Weather app, it may not function correctly.
  • Background app refresh is disabled: Background app refresh allows the Weather app to update its data in the background while you use other apps or when your iPhone is locked. If this feature is disabled for the Weather app, it may not have the latest weather information when you open it.
  • Weak or unstable internet connection: A stable internet connection is crucial for the Weather app to fetch the most recent weather data from online sources. If your Wi-Fi or cellular data connection is weak or unstable, the app may not be able to update its information accurately.
  • Outdated or buggy iOS version: Using an old iOS version can sometimes introduce glitches or issues that affect the Weather app’s performance. It is always recommended to keep your iPhone updated to the latest iOS version to ensure compatibility and stability with various apps, including the Weather app.
  • Corrupted app or software issues: In some cases, the Weather app itself may be corrupted or experiencing internal software issues. This could prevent the app from functioning normally and require you to take specific actions to resolve the problem.

Step 2: Close and Reopen the Weather App

Sometimes, the Weather app may experience temporary glitches or cache-related problems that can impact its functionality. In such cases, a simple solution is to close and reopen the app, giving it a fresh start. Here’s how you can do it:

  1. Swipe up from the bottom of your iPhone screen to the center and hold until you see the App Switcher. If you have an iPhone 8 or an earlier model, simply double-tap the Home button instead.
  2. In the App Switcher, locate the Weather app card. It will appear as a preview of the app.
  3. Swipe upward on the Weather app card to close it. This will force the app to quit.
  4. Wait for a few moments, and then reopen the Weather app by tapping on its icon.
  5. Check if the app is working properly now. If not, proceed to the next step.

Step 3: Restart Your iPhone

Restarting your iPhone can resolve minor software glitches that may be affecting the Weather app. A reboot can clear temporary cache issues and refresh the operating system, potentially fixing any problems with the app. Here’s how to restart your iPhone:

  1. Press and hold the power button (or the side button, depending on your iPhone model) until a slider appears on the display.
  2. Drag the slider to turn off your iPhone completely.
  3. Wait for at least 30 seconds, and then press and hold the power button (or side button) again until you see the Apple logo appear on the screen. This indicates that your iPhone is turning back on.
  4. Alternatively, you can also use Siri to restart your device. Simply say, “Hey Siri, restart my iPhone,” and follow the prompts.
  5. Once your iPhone has restarted, check if the Weather app is functioning correctly.

Step 4: Enable Location Access or Reset Location & Privacy

The Weather app relies on your iPhone’s location services to provide you with accurate weather information for your current location. If location services are disabled or not granted permission for the Weather app, it won’t be able to function properly. Here’s how to ensure location access is enabled:


  1. Go to your iPhone’s Settings.
  2. Tap on “Privacy & Security.”
  3. Select “Location Services.”
  4. Make sure the “Location Services” option is turned on. If it is off, toggle it on.
  5. Scroll down and locate the “Weather” app in the list of apps.
  6. Tap on “Weather” and select “While Using the App” or “Always” to grant location access. “While Using the App” will allow the Weather app to access your location only when you actively use the app. “Always” will grant the app access to your location even when it’s running in the background.
  7. If the app still doesn’t work, you can try resetting the “Location & Privacy” data. Go to Settings > General > Reset.
  8. Tap on “Reset Location & Privacy.” This will reset all location and privacy settings, including those for the Weather app.
  9. By enabling Location Services, you are also activating the “Significant Locations” feature. This feature allows your iPhone to keep track of the places you visit frequently and the times you were at each location. If you prefer to keep this information private, you can refer to our guide on turning off location history.
  10. After making these changes, open the Weather app and check if it is functioning as expected.

Step 5: Turn on Background App Refresh

Background App Refresh allows apps to refresh their content and perform specific tasks in the background, even when they are not actively in use. This ensures that apps like Weather stay up-to-date with the latest information, such as current temperatures and forecasts. To enable Background App Refresh for the Weather app:

  1. Go to Settings on your iPhone.
  2. Tap on “General.”
  3. Select “Background App Refresh.”
  4. Make sure that “Background App Refresh” is turned on. If it is off, toggle it on.
  5. Scroll down or search for the “Weather” app in the list of apps.
  6. Toggle on the switch next to “Weather” to enable background app refresh for the app.
  7. With Background App Refresh enabled, your iPhone will intelligently schedule these updates based on your usage patterns, device energy, and network connection. This helps reduce battery consumption and ensures that updates occur when your device is connected to Wi-Fi or has a strong cellular signal.
  8. Open the Weather app and see if it is now updating the weather information in the background as expected.

Step 6: Check Your Internet Connectivity

A stable internet connection is crucial for the Weather app to retrieve the latest weather data from online sources. If your iPhone is not connected to a Wi-Fi network or has a weak cellular data signal, the app may not function properly. Here’s how to check your internet connectivity:

  1. Go to Settings > Wi-Fi to verify your Wi-Fi connection.
  2. Ensure that Wi-Fi is turned on. If it is off, toggle it on.
  3. Check if your iPhone is connected to a Wi-Fi network. If not, select a network and enter the password, if required.
  4. To check your cellular data connection, go to Settings > Cellular.
  5. Ensure that “Cellular Data” is turned on.
  6. Check if you have a strong signal reception by looking at the signal bars in the status bar at the top of your iPhone screen.
  7. If your internet connection seems unstable, try restarting your router or contacting your service provider for further assistance.
  8. Once you have a stable internet connection, open the Weather app and see if it is able to update the weather information correctly.

Step 7: Update to the Latest iOS Version

Keeping your iPhone updated to the latest iOS version is essential for ensuring the smooth performance of all apps, including the Weather app. Updates often include bug fixes and improvements that can resolve any issues impacting the Weather app or other applications on your device. To update your iPhone:

  1. Go to Settings > General > Software Update.
  2. Your iPhone will check for available updates. If an update is available, you will see the option to “Download and Install.”
  3. Tap on “Download and Install” to begin the update process.
  4. Follow the on-screen instructions, if any, and wait for the update to complete.
  5. Once your iPhone has been updated to the latest iOS version, open the Weather app and check if it is functioning correctly.

Step 8: Delete and Reinstall the Weather App

If the Weather app is corrupted or has damaged files, it may exhibit issues and malfunctions. In this case, reinstalling the app can help eliminate any problematic data and restore its functionality. Here’s how to uninstall and reinstall the Weather app:

  1. Press and hold the Weather app icon on your iPhone’s home screen until a contextual menu appears.
  2. Tap on “Remove App” and then confirm by tapping on “Delete App.” This will uninstall the Weather app from your iPhone.
  3. Open the App Store and search for “Weather” in the search bar.
  4. Locate the Weather app from the search results and tap on the cloud download button to reinstall it.
  5. If you cannot find the App Store or it is missing from your iPhone, refer to our dedicated guide on restoring the App Store.
  6. Once the Weather app has been reinstalled, open it and check if it is working correctly.
